Originally Posted by Boco
Another post got me thinking about this.
I have never seen skunk or otter climb although I believe they could.I have seen groundhogs climb small brush.
I would be interested in hearing first hand information(no hearsay or old wives tales) about animals not normally associated with being arboreal that trappers have seen climbing.
I have caught several foxes over the years in elevated marten boxes on trees 5 feet up(no running pole).I believe these animals jumped up(not climbed) on top of the box and were caught.

Someone posted picture on a Manitoba based face book page of an otter caught in a marten box.
